While the Shenzhen Metro Line 1 is a great option for travelers, there are a few pain points to keep in mind. For example, during peak hours, the trains can get extremely crowded, making it difficult to find a seat or even stand comfortably. Additionally, some of the stations can be confusing to navigate, especially if you are not familiar with the local language or the city layout.

FAQs About Shenzhen Metro Line 1
Q: Can I use the Shenzhen Metro Line 1 to travel to other cities?
A: No, the Shenzhen Metro Line 1 is only for traveling within the city of Shenzhen.
Q: Are there any discounts available for using the metro line?
A: Yes, you can purchase a rechargeable Shenzhen Tong card, which offers discounts on metro fares and other public transportation options in the city.
